Shloka 39

Droṇa–Arjuna Yuddha; Trigarta-Āvaraṇa; Bhīmasena Gajānīka-bheda

Droṇa and Arjuna Engage; Trigarta Containment; Bhīma Breaks the Elephant Corps

तमापततन्तं सम्प्रेक्ष्य पाण्डवानां महारथा: । अभ्यवर्तन्त वेगेन भीमसेनपुरोगमा:,उस हाथीको आते देख भीमसेन आदि पाण्डव महारथी शीघ्रतापूर्वक उसके चारों ओर खड़े हो गये

tam āpatatantaṃ samprekṣya pāṇḍavānāṃ mahārathāḥ | abhyavartanta vegena bhīmasena-purogamāḥ ||

Sañjaya said: Seeing that elephant charging toward them, the great chariot-warriors of the Pāṇḍavas—led by Bhīmasena—swiftly moved forward and took their positions around it, meeting the onrush with disciplined courage and protective resolve amid the chaos of war.
